Hi,

We have a Call Manager 3.3(3) cluster ( 4 servers ) and we are getting DC directory error " No free connection - control blocks - connection refused".The screen shot of the error is attached.

This error keeps repeating and after some time the server stops responding.After restarting the server it starts working fine.

Pls let us know what is causing this problem.

The above error is caused by the application that is accessing DC Directory, not necessarily the CallManager. You will need to monitor your Publisher to see what server is opening TCP connecitons on port 8404. Netstat -an from a cmd prompt will help. Look for the server that has many connections open. We find this issue most often with CRS. Take a look at CSCee82637 regarding the issue with CRS.
